Design a Fuzzy Logic Controller for an Artificial Pancreas System
Design a complex fuzzy logic controller by combining two smaller interconnected fuzzy systems in a fuzzy tree. In this example, design an artificial pancreas nonlinear control system in Simulink® using fuzzy logic.
Automatically tune the membership function parameters and rules of a fuzzy inference system. Use Simulink to model the fuzzy logic controller, insulin pump, glucose production from a meal, and blood glucose changes in the patient. Validate the fuzzy logic controller by simulating various meal scenarios. Deploy the fuzzy logic controller by automatically generating C/C++ code.
